Output 592c994be9976d9208f62bdeadaf81440cf584ff20b3c9dbc84d09eed8c1028c:40

value
516846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6befe860767b428cb3a96d0301471fd36b7ad4bc OP_EQUAL
address
3BXjd9g3nhvcP9q943FQuEDwLUHxgkeuxu
transaction
592c994be9976d9208f62bdeadaf81440cf584ff20b3c9dbc84d09eed8c1028c
spent
true